[0001] This invention belongs to the technical field of tunnel boring machine (TBM) hoisting, specifically relating to a method for hoisting and installing a single-shield TBM. Background Technology

[0002] Tunnel boring machine (TBM) construction is currently widely used in tunnel construction. When encountering confined spaces, TBMs typically need to excavate and push tunnels in the tunnel from the starting shaft. The TBM is first hoisted into the starting shaft, and then pushed into the tunnel for launch. In existing technologies, a concrete guide platform is poured inside the tunnel, and the shield body is assembled on the platform. This requires a certain diameter for the starting shaft. In addition, to ensure the shield body's posture during push-out, negative ring segments need to be assembled and then filled with gravel. This method has limited control over the shield body's posture and is quite cumbersome, making construction difficult.

[0032] like Figure 1 As shown, a single-shield TBM hoisting and installation method includes the following steps: Step S1, construction of the starting guide platform 2, guide tunnel 8 and empty propulsion platform 3, hardening of the ground outside the working well 1 by mixing piles, the mixing piles are mainly distributed on the travel trajectory of the hoisting equipment, and then the outside of the working well 1 is hardened as a whole by concrete. Due to the limited assembly site, the single-shield TBM hoisting and lowering channel has only one well opening, and it is planned to use a 650T gantry crane and a 500T crawler crane for hoisting and assembly.

[0033] The empty propulsion platform 3 is located inside the guide hole 8. The rear end of the empty propulsion platform 3 extends out of the guide hole 8 by a certain distance, which is adapted to the thickness of the cutter head. A gap is left between the empty propulsion platform 3 and the launching guide platform 2 to serve as a circumferential welding channel 4. Longitudinal welding channels corresponding to the shield body 5 are provided on both sides of the launching guide platform 2.

[0034] Step S2: Divide both the middle shield and the front shield into six lifting blocks, naming the top lifting block of the middle shield "Middle Lifting Block One," as follows: Figure 3 As shown, the remaining lifting blocks of the middle shield are named in clockwise order as Middle Lifting Block 2, Middle Lifting Block 3, Middle Lifting Block 4, Middle Lifting Block 5, and Middle Lifting Block 6; the top lifting block of the front shield is named Front Lifting Block 1, and the remaining lifting blocks of the front shield are named in clockwise order as Front Lifting Block 2, Front Lifting Block 3, Front Lifting Block 4, Front Lifting Block 5, and Front Lifting Block 6. First, Front Lifting Block 3, Front Lifting Block 4, and Front Lifting Block 5 are lowered into the well and pre-tightened. The bottom block assembly lifting cylinder of the shield body 5 is set at the starting guide platform 2. It consists of 4 lifting cylinders and is used to adjust the position and height difference during the assembly of the bottom block of the shield body 5.

[0035] The front shield is located at the front end of the launching guide platform 2, so that the front end face of the front shield is above the circumferential welding channel 4. Then, the hydraulic cylinder and reaction seat corresponding to the front shield are installed. Specifically, reaction grooves are set on both sides of the launching guide platform 2 and the empty thrust platform 3, with the opening of the reaction groove facing upward. The reaction grooves are formed by pre-embedded metal grooves during the casting process. The reaction seat is installed in the reaction groove in a detachable manner. The reaction seat is a block shape corresponding to the reaction groove and is welded from steel plates. The reaction seat is connected to the hydraulic cylinder, and the hydraulic cylinder is connected to the outer wall of the shield body 5 in a hinged manner, thereby realizing the advancement of the shield body 5.

[0036] After welding, the cutter head is flipped and lowered to the rear end of the empty pusher platform 3, thus supporting the cutter head through the empty pusher platform 3. At this time, the gap between the cutter head and the front shield is located at the circumferential welding channel 4. The cutter head and the front lifting blocks three, four and five are pre-tightened through the circumferential welding channel 4. Two limit blocks are welded on both sides of the front lifting block four along the outer side of the track to prevent the bottom block from sliding during the installation of other sub-blocks. Sealing strips are installed on the sub-block connecting surfaces and flat sealant is applied. Pre-tightened sub-block connecting bolts are installed.

[0037] In step S3, the cutterhead and front shield are pushed forward along the starting guide platform 2 so that the rear end face of the front shield is above the circumferential welding channel 4. Then, the middle lifting blocks 3, 4, and 5 are sequentially lowered into the well and connected to the front shield, thereby welding and fixing the front shield and the middle shield. After the main drive is hoisted into the well, it is connected to the cutterhead. Then, the front lifting blocks 2, 6, 1, 2, 6, and 1 are sequentially hoisted into the well. The middle shield, main drive, front shield, and cutterhead are connected as one unit through assembly.

[0038] In this embodiment, as the shield body 5 is pushed forward, corresponding hydraulic cylinders and reaction seats are installed on the outside of the middle shield and the tail shield respectively. Multiple reaction grooves on both sides of the launching guide platform 2 and the empty thrust guide platform 3 are evenly distributed along the large mileage direction. In this way, the hydraulic cylinder can be reciprocated by adjusting the position of the reaction seat during the forward pushing process, thereby continuously pushing the shield body 5 forward.

[0039] Step S4: After pushing the shield body 5 forward, the cross beam and shield tail are lowered and connected through the circumferential welding channel 4. Emergency airbags and articulated seals are installed. Before installing the seals, the articulated rings must be welded in advance, and the welds must be ground smooth. After connecting the hydraulic pump station to the shield body 5, the shield body 5 is pushed forward by the hydraulic cylinder. Then, the trailer is lowered and connected in sequence, and the top-level equipment is installed. After the pipeline connection is debugged, the shield body 5 is pushed to the starting excavation position.

[0040] In this embodiment, the air-propellant platform 3 and the launching platform 2 are pre-cast concrete platforms with an upper surface that corresponds to the arc shape of the shield body 5. The centerlines of the air-propellant platform 3 and the launching platform 2 coincide with the centerline of the tunnel, and the axial deviation cannot exceed ±20mm. Interconnected air-propellant tracks are laid on the air-propellant platform 3 and the launching platform 2. The air-propellant tracks can be I-beams and are fixed to the air-propellant platform 3 and the launching platform 2 by embedded parts. Lubricating oil is applied to the top of the air-propellant tracks. Specifically, two 120kg steel rails are arranged on each side of the air-propellant platform 3 and the launching platform 2, welded to steel plates embedded in the concrete of the platform, to provide tracks for the single-shield TBM to advance. The reaction seat is designed as a 500*500*30mm steel plate in both vertical and horizontal directions. A 400*400*1100mm vertical barrel groove is welded to the rear of the vertical steel plate and reinforced with a triangular rib plate. It is inserted into the embedded part of the guide platform. The horizontal steel plate is welded to the embedded part on the guide platform.

[0041] In one optional embodiment, the cutterhead is transported to the construction site in sections for assembly and welding. During cutterhead welding, the connecting welds between the side blocks and the center block are welded first, followed by the welds on the secondary cutter beams, and finally the welds on the large circular ring and other welds. Insulation measures are implemented during welding. After the overall cutterhead welding is completed, the tooling is removed. The shield tail is installed in four sections. When installing the bottom block, its centerline is aligned with the centerlines of the front and middle shields, and its front end is aligned with the tail section of the middle shield. Then, the left, right, and top blocks are installed sequentially. During the shield tail installation process, the anti-deformation support of the shield tail cannot be removed prematurely to prevent deformation of the thin-walled cylinder. A total station is used throughout the process to measure whether there is any deviation in the placement of the tail shield, and to measure the distance from the inner circle of the bottom block to the centerline. Adjustments are made promptly as needed to ensure the overall roundness of the shield tail and its coaxiality with the middle and front shields.

[0042] After the tail shield welding is completed, the tail shield brushes are assembled. The starting points of the welding of the four tail shield brushes must be 1m apart, and the welds of the second, third, and fourth tail shield brushes must be in the middle of the previous tail shield brush.

[0043] The main drive uses a tilting lug and a tilting support. The tilting lug is installed on the housing assembly facing upwards, and the tilting support is installed on the ground side. They are then tightened and secured with bolts.

[0044] In an optional embodiment, to prevent the shield 5 from twisting during the air thrusting process, anti-twist pads are welded at the contact position between the shield 5 and the rail. The lower end face of the anti-twist pads is provided with rollers. Flat platforms are provided on both sides of the air thrusting guide platform 3 or the starting guide platform 2 for material transportation and personnel walking. The rollers are supported on the flat platforms on both sides of the air thrusting guide platform 3 or the starting guide platform 2 to avoid the shield 5 from rotating due to uneven force. Preferably, 6 anti-twist pads are welded to the middle shield and the front shield, and 2 anti-twist pads are welded to the tail shield.

[0045] Furthermore, to prevent the shield body 5 from buoyancy during air thrusting, this application does not use negative pressure segments, but instead provides a corresponding anti-buoyancy mechanism for the shield body 5 within the guide tunnel 8. The anti-buoyancy mechanism includes guide rails 6 and sliding blocks 7. At least two guide rails 6 extend along the mileage direction of the guide tunnel 8. In this application, five guide rails 6 are provided, evenly distributed in the upper half of the guide tunnel 8 and circumferentially. Specifically, one of the five guide rails 6 is located at the arch, and the other four guide rails 6 are symmetrically distributed within a 180° range on both sides of the arch. The guide rails 6 can be dovetail grooves, and multiple sliding blocks 7 are slidably mounted within the guide rails 6. Each sliding block 7 has a dovetail-shaped slider 9 corresponding to the dovetail groove. Figure 2 As shown, the slide block 7 is equipped with a push rod 10, which can be a pneumatic cylinder or a hydraulic cylinder. The side of the guide rail 6 has evenly distributed hooks corresponding to the hydraulic cylinder's hydraulic pipes, allowing for the arrangement and storage of the hydraulic pipes. The end of the push rod 10 is equipped with an arc-shaped support plate 11 corresponding to the outer wall of the shield body 5. The arc-shaped support plate 11 is adapted to the outer wall of the shield body 5. One end of the guide rail 6 extends to the shield working face, and the other end protrudes from the guide hole 8 to facilitate the insertion of the slide block 7. During the advancement of the shield body 5, the anti-buoyancy mechanism enters the guide hole 8 synchronously with the shield body 5. Specifically, according to the advancement progress, multiple slide blocks 7 are sequentially and spaced within each guide rail 6, providing multiple anti-buoyancy mechanisms along the length of the shield body 5. The mechanism is evenly distributed. The slide block 7 is supported on the outer wall of the shield body 5 by the top rod 10 and slides synchronously with the shield body 5 in the guide rail 6, thereby providing anti-buoyancy support for the upper part of the shield body 5. Multiple positioning detection points are evenly distributed on the shield body 5. The positioning detection points are monitored by a total station to obtain the attitude of the shield body 5. The attitude of the shield body 5 is adjusted by adjusting the length of the top rod 10 based on the attitude of the shield body 5, thereby ensuring the stability of the shield body 5 during air thrust. When the excavation begins, the slider 9 abuts against the end of the guide tunnel 8, thereby sliding relative to the shield body 5 and then separating from the shield body 5. Furthermore, the shield body 5 can be adjusted when it begins to enter the tunnel, ensuring the accuracy of the shield body 5 entering the tunnel.

[0046] In this embodiment, the length of the guide rail 6 extending into the working well 1 is adapted to the length of the slide block 7. The guide rail 6 can extend to the outer periphery of the guide hole 8, and the part extending out of the outer periphery of the guide hole 8 transitions into the hole through an arc or an incline, thereby facilitating the installation of the slide block 7. The middle part of the slide block 7 is provided with a mounting hole corresponding to the top rod 10, and the diameter of the mounting hole is adapted to the top rod 10.
